注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)程序設(shè)計(jì)綜合軟件開發(fā)實(shí)驗(yàn)與實(shí)踐教程

軟件開發(fā)實(shí)驗(yàn)與實(shí)踐教程

軟件開發(fā)實(shí)驗(yàn)與實(shí)踐教程

定 價(jià):¥22.00

作 者: 陳佳,曹妍 編著
出版社: 清華大學(xué)出版社
叢編項(xiàng): 高等院校計(jì)算機(jī)實(shí)驗(yàn)與實(shí)踐系列示范教材
標(biāo) 簽: 暫缺

ISBN: 9787302132493 出版時(shí)間: 2006-08-01 包裝: 平裝
開本: 16開 頁數(shù): 228 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  本書將在軟件開發(fā)進(jìn)程中采用一個(gè)案例貫穿需求分析、系統(tǒng)分析、系統(tǒng)設(shè)計(jì)的全過程,并通過實(shí)踐指導(dǎo)的方式介紹每個(gè)階段的工作方法、文檔規(guī)范及工具的使用,引導(dǎo)開發(fā)人員進(jìn)行軟件開發(fā)。.本書分為6章。第1章介紹Visio、Rational Rose和ERwin工具的安裝;第2~5章在對(duì)一個(gè)案例需求進(jìn)行詳細(xì)描述的基礎(chǔ)上,根據(jù)案例的實(shí)際業(yè)務(wù)介紹需求分析、系統(tǒng)分析、系統(tǒng)設(shè)計(jì)階段的工作方法,并利用開發(fā)工具指導(dǎo)各階段的開發(fā)實(shí)踐;第6章介紹在開發(fā)過程中如何使用版本控制工具CVS進(jìn)行軟件開發(fā)項(xiàng)目管理。.本書可作為計(jì)算機(jī)專業(yè)、信息管理與信息系統(tǒng)專業(yè)的專業(yè)實(shí)踐教材,同時(shí)也可作為軟件開發(fā)人員的參考書。...

作者簡(jiǎn)介

暫缺《軟件開發(fā)實(shí)驗(yàn)與實(shí)踐教程》作者簡(jiǎn)介

圖書目錄

第1章  軟件開發(fā)文檔工具安裝    1
1.1  Visio的安裝實(shí)驗(yàn)    1
1.1.1  Visio簡(jiǎn)介    1
1.1.2  Visio的安裝步驟    2
1.2  Rational Rose的安裝實(shí)驗(yàn)    5
1.2.1  Rational Rose簡(jiǎn)介    5
1.2.2  Rational Rose的安裝步驟    6
1.3  ERwin的安裝實(shí)驗(yàn)    9
1.3.1  ERwin簡(jiǎn)介    9
1.3.2  ERwin的安裝步驟    10
第2章  需求分析    16
2.1  系統(tǒng)可行性分析實(shí)驗(yàn)    16
2.1.1  軟件開發(fā)必要性分析    16
2.1.2  軟件開發(fā)技術(shù)可行性分析    18
2.2  基于Visio的業(yè)務(wù)流程實(shí)驗(yàn)    18
2.2.1  概述    18
2.2.2  業(yè)務(wù)流程調(diào)查    19
2.2.3  利用Visio繪制業(yè)務(wù)流程圖    21
2.3  基于UML的用例模型實(shí)驗(yàn)    31
2.3.1  用例圖    32
2.3.2  活動(dòng)圖    39
2.3.3  使用Visio繪制用例模型    41
2.3.4  使用Rational Rose繪制用例模型    51
2.4  基于UML的狀態(tài)模型實(shí)驗(yàn)    64
2.4.1  狀態(tài)圖    65
2.4.2  使用Visio繪制狀態(tài)模型    65
2.4.3  使用Rational Rose繪制狀態(tài)模型    71
第3章  功能分析    75
3.1  基于Visio的數(shù)據(jù)流程圖    75
3.1.1  數(shù)據(jù)流程圖    75
3.1.2  利用Visio繪制數(shù)據(jù)流程圖    78
3.2  基于UML的類模型實(shí)驗(yàn)    80
3.2.1  類分析及類圖    81
3.2.2  使用Visio繪制類圖    87
3.2.3  使用Rational Rose繪制類圖    91
3.3  基于UML的順序圖邏輯模型    101
3.3.1  順序圖    101
3.3.2  使用Visio繪制順序圖    104
3.3.3  使用Rational Rose繪制順序圖    108
第4章  數(shù)據(jù)分析與數(shù)據(jù)庫(kù)設(shè)計(jì)    112
4.1  數(shù)據(jù)分析    112
4.2  數(shù)據(jù)庫(kù)邏輯模型設(shè)計(jì)實(shí)驗(yàn)    116
4.2.1  ERwin的使用    116
4.2.2  建立實(shí)體    119
4.2.3  建立實(shí)體的屬性    121
4.2.4  建立實(shí)體之間的聯(lián)系    126
4.3  數(shù)據(jù)庫(kù)物理模型設(shè)計(jì)實(shí)驗(yàn)    136
4.3.1  目標(biāo)數(shù)據(jù)庫(kù)的設(shè)置    136
4.3.2  物理字段的設(shè)計(jì)    137
4.3.3  表與視圖的設(shè)計(jì)    141
4.4  雙向工程實(shí)驗(yàn)    148
4.4.1  正向工程實(shí)驗(yàn)    148
4.4.2  反向工程實(shí)驗(yàn)    149
第5章  功能設(shè)計(jì)    152
5.1  功能結(jié)構(gòu)設(shè)計(jì)實(shí)驗(yàn)    152
5.1.1  功能模塊的結(jié)構(gòu)圖    152
5.1.2  利用Visio繪制結(jié)構(gòu)圖    155
5.1.3  撰寫模塊說明書    160
5.2  UML模型設(shè)計(jì)實(shí)驗(yàn)    167
5.2.1  使用Rational Rose設(shè)計(jì)UML模型    167
5.2.2  使用Visio繪制UML設(shè)計(jì)模型    195
5.3  UML包的制作與模型生成    201
5.3.1  UML包的制作    201
5.3.2  模型的生成    203
第6章  版本控制工具的使用    205
6.1  版本控制簡(jiǎn)介    205
6.2  版本控制工具的安裝    206
6.2.1  CVS服務(wù)器端軟件——CVSNT的安裝    206
6.2.2  CVS客戶端軟件——TortoiseCVS(TCVS)的安裝    208
6.3  TCVS的基本使用方法    209
6.3.1  TCVS的基本操作    209
6.3.2  利用TCVS進(jìn)行版本控制    213
6.4  版本控制實(shí)驗(yàn)    217
6.4.1  CVS倉(cāng)庫(kù)與本地沙盒的創(chuàng)建和配置    217
6.4.2  提交在本地開發(fā)文檔文件    221
6.4.3  開發(fā)文檔的控制    223
參考文獻(xiàn)    229

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) hotzeplotz.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)